Job Description
  • Process guest registrations, check-ins, check-outs, room assignments, and key issuance efficiently, accurately, and courteously.
  • Coordinate guest room billing, settle guest accounts, and adhere to all cashiering, credit, and financial procedures.
  • Block and assign rooms in the PMS, ensuring designated room requirements, preferences, and special requests are communicated and followed through.
  • Communicate hotel services, amenities, outlets, hours of operation, promotions, and special offerings clearly and confidently to guests.
  • Maintain complete knowledge of guest room types, layouts, bed configurations, décor, appointments, locations, and applicable room rates and packages.
  • Maintain awareness of daily house count, room availability, expected arrivals and departures, VIPs, special requests, and in-house guests.
  • Generate, print, review, and distribute daily and weekly operational reports as required.
  • Assist other Front Office departments and operational teams as needed to ensure a seamless guest experience.

Royal Service & Guest Communications – Flex Duties

  • Serve as a telephone concierge, answering internal and external calls promptly and professionally while following established hotel telephone etiquette.
  • Process, log, and distribute incoming guest communications through email and digital messaging platforms, including Kipsu, in a timely and professional manner.
  • Receive, document, dispatch, and follow up on guest requests through Royal Service management software, ensuring requests are completed and guest satisfaction is confirmed.
  • Respond promptly and professionally to guest requests across all communication channels, anticipating needs and providing personalized service.
  • Handle In-Room Dining (IRD) order calls, utilize suggestive selling and upselling techniques, and coordinate with IRD and Culinary teams to facilitate accurate and timely delivery.
  • Transition seamlessly between Front Desk and Royal Service responsibilities based on scheduled flex duties, operational demands, and peak activity periods.

Guest Relations & Service Recovery

  • Anticipate guest needs, acknowledge all guests warmly, and provide attentive, personalized service regardless of operational volume or time of day.
  • Maintain positive guest relations and demonstrate professionalism, discretion, and genuine hospitality in every guest interaction.
  • Respond to and resolve guest concerns and complaints promptly, utilizing appropriate service recovery techniques and escalating issues when necessary.
  • Document guest concerns, requests, and service recovery efforts accurately and ensure appropriate follow-up.
  • Build guest loyalty through personalized service, recognition of guest preferences, and active promotion and participation in the hotel's loyalty program.
  • Maintain awareness of in-house groups, meetings, events, VIP arrivals, and other activities that may impact the guest experience.

Reservations & Administrative Support

  • Enter, update, confirm, and process room reservations, cancellations, modifications, and date changes in accordance with established reservation policies and procedures.
  • Enter group rooming lists as directed and coordinate with Sales, Conference Services, and other departments as required.
  • Assist guests with folio inquiries, billing questions, account adjustments, and other Front Office-related requests.
